Situated in the heart of the charming town of Linlithgow, just 20 miles west of Edinburgh, Linlithgow train station serves as a key gateway to a wealth of Scottish locales. Whether you're a local heading into the city for work, a student, or a traveler exploring Scotland, the station offers a blend of essential amenities and convenient transport links to make your journey smooth and enjoyable.
The station is equipped with a ticket office that operates from early morning until late at night, ensuring that you can always secure a ticket for your travels. For those who prefer online booking, ticket collection is facilitated by accessible ticket machines located at the station. Moreover, for passengers with hearing impairments, an induction loop is available, enhancing accessibility.
Independently navigating the station is straightforward due to the comprehensive step-free access provided throughout. Despite having no accessible toilets, the station offers waiting rooms on both platforms where travelers can also access public Wi-Fi. If you're looking to grab a quick refreshment, a coffee vending machine is on hand to cater to your caffeine needs before you embark on your journey.
Linlithgow station boasts substantial connectivity with various modes of transport ensuring seamless travel. Should railway services be disrupted, a rail replacement service operates with buses picking up passengers from High Street. For detailed information about bus services, visit Traveline Scotland or call their 24-hour hotline. Taxi services are equally accessible, with details available at TrainTaxi.
Parking is hassle-free with a no-charge policy, as there are 96 parking spaces available, inclusive of two blue badge spaces. Cyclists are also catered to with a covered bicycle storage area accommodating up to 38 bikes, protected by CCTV for enhanced security.

Travelling in and out of London can be an exhilarating experience, and if you're passing through Heathrow Terminal 5, you'll find yourself at one of the world's busiest and most efficient transport hubs. This standalone rail station is your portal to many UK destinations and offers a range of services that cater to every traveller's needs. Whether you're arriving in the capital for the first time or heading off on another adventure, Heathrow Terminal 5 will help you on your way with ease and efficiency.
At the heart of this station are the ticket buying and collection facilities, which are open daily from 5:00 AM until 11:59 PM. Convenient ticket machines are available, as well as accessible options and an induction loop for those with hearing impairments. While the smartcard technology isn't part of the system yet, collecting online purchased tickets couldn't be simpler.
Help and support are readily available with staff assistance offered all week from 5:00 AM to midnight, and customer help points are strategically placed to assist passengers. The station also provides comprehensive accessibility options such as step-free access throughout, wheelchair usability on platforms, and accessible toilets.
Navigating onward from Heathrow Terminal 5 is seamlessly integrated with local transport. The station has connections with the London Underground's Piccadilly Line, providing a direct line to central London. Furthermore, ample taxi ranks are available at the airport terminals for easy onward travel.
For those thinking of driving, car hire services are conveniently situated within the terminal itself. Additionally, printable information to support your onward journey via bus can be accessed online. Heathrow's fantastic connectivity means you can travel with ease, without stress or confusion.
